TechCrunch Disrupt 2026’s new Real World AI Stage features Nvidia, robots, and extinct animals
TechCrunch Disrupt 2026 will once again place AI at the heart of its program, but with a new twist: a dedicated Real World AI Stage. The event, taking place October 13‑15 at San Francisco’s Moscone West, expands its AI offerings by introducing this fresh stage, which explores the intersection of digital and physical realms. It will highlight how autonomous hardware is moving beyond self‑driving cars to occupy public spaces, battlefields, homes, and even potentially aid extinct species in re‑entering Earth. The lineup features speakers from leading companies such as Shield AI, Colossal Biosciences, FieldAI, Foxglove, and Nvidia, among others still to be announced.
The first session tackles the data gap that hampers general‑purpose robotic intelligence. While large language models had the internet and self‑driving cars have millions of hours of road data, robots lack that foundational data. This shortfall is the primary reason most experts believe broad robotic AI is still years away, despite breakthroughs elsewhere in AI. A new wave of startups is racing to close this gap by building data pipelines, simulation environments, and foundation models that could spark a capability explosion similar to that seen with LLMs. Les Karpas, Head of Physical AI at Nvidia, will lead a discussion on what the ChatGPT moment for physical AI truly requires and how close we really are.
The second session focuses on safety and readiness when AI enters the physical world. A mistake can ground an aircraft, crash a vehicle, or jeopardize a mission. Leaders building autonomous vehicles, defense technologies, and industrial systems will address one of the toughest questions every hard‑tech founder faces: how to know when a system is safe to deploy. The panel will explore how founders can cultivate a safety culture, test and validate AI, navigate regulatory hurdles, and build trust in high‑stakes environments. Nate Michael, CTO of Shield AI, will participate in this discussion.
The third session, a fireside chat, features Ben Lamm, CEO of Colossal Biosciences, a company known for turning de‑extinction from science fiction into a billion‑dollar business. Lamm will discuss the technologies used to revive extinct species, the role AI plays in modern biology, and the growing debate over whether engineering nature is a conservation breakthrough or a distraction from protecting existing wildlife. His talk highlights the ethical, technical, and commercial dimensions of attempting to bring back lost species.
The fourth session brings together leaders in edge AI from defense, space, and industrial sectors. Dr. Ali Agha, CEO and founder of FieldAI; Michelle Lee, CEO and founder of Medra; and Aidan Madigan‑Curtis, partner at Eclipse Ventures, will share how they have made AI work where latency matters, connectivity is limited, and failure is not an option. Expect practical lessons on architectural principles, design decisions, and trade‑offs that enable AI‑centric systems to function in real‑world conditions. These insights have direct implications for companies deploying AI in challenging environments.
Finally, the fifth session addresses the critical transition from prototype to production and scaling. Founders who have successfully crossed this gap in space hardware, humanoid robotics, and autonomous systems will share what they got wrong, what they would have done earlier, and what the prototype‑to‑production journey looks like when supply chains and manufacturing realities replace lab conditions. John Mackey will contribute his perspective on navigating this complex path. The panel underscores the practical challenges and strategies needed to move from a working prototype to a scalable, profitable business, offering actionable takeaways for deep‑tech startups.
